SBP notifies subsidized loans for Naya Pakistan housing scheme

The State Bank of Pakistan (SBP) announced three different categories of subsidized mark-up rates for housing finance with a maximum tenure of payment extended to 20 years, on Monday

“This facility will allow all individuals, who will be constructing or buying a new house for the first time, to avail bank’s financing at subsidized and affordable mark-up rates,” statement from the SBP. 

The facility, according to the central bank, will be provided with the administrative help of the State Bank of Pakistan as an executing partner with Government of Pakistan and Naya Pakistan Housing and Development Authority (NAPHDA). 

According to the SBP, the government has allocated Rs. 33 billion for payment of mark-up subsidy for financing over a period of 10 years and has assured continuity of the facility.
